Image Editing Innovations

The field of image editing is moving towards more efficient and effective methods, with a focus on preserving high-frequency features and achieving precise control over the editing process. Recent developments have introduced new frameworks and techniques that enable robust multi-turn editing, layered visual cues, and direct drag-based manipulation. These innovations have improved the quality and fidelity of edited images, allowing for more intuitive and interactive editing experiences. Notable papers include:

  • Reversible Inversion, which achieves state-of-the-art performance with low computational overhead.
  • FreqEdit, which enables stable editing across multiple iterations.
  • MagicQuillV2, which introduces a layered composition paradigm for generative image editing.
  • DirectDrag, which provides high-fidelity mask-free and prompt-free editing.
